About Painter

A Painter (for residential and commercial work) prepares surfaces and applies coatings to walls, ceilings, trim, doors, and sometimes metalwork. The best results come from preparation—not just the paint itself—so expect time spent on protection, patching, sanding, priming, and proper drying/curing.

You typically need a Painter in Tianjin when:

  • You’re moving into a new-build and want better finishes than the developer-grade coating
  • Walls are stained, yellowed, cracked, or patched after plumbing/electrical work
  • You’ve had moisture issues and need sealing plus repainting (scope depends on the cause)
  • You’re renovating a kitchen, bathroom, or retail space and need durable, washable coatings
  • You need a fast turnover repaint before listing a rental or reopening a shop

Key takeaways

  • Prep work (repair, sanding, priming) is often the biggest quality difference.
  • Written scope prevents disputes: number of coats, brand/grade, and what’s included.
  • Moisture problems must be solved before repainting, or stains/bubbling may return.
  • “Low price” often means less prep, fewer coats, or lower-grade materials.

Cost of Hiring a Painter in Tianjin

Average price range: Not publicly stated as a reliable, standardized citywide range. In practice, painting quotes in Tianjin commonly differ based on whether you’re hiring a standalone Painter crew or a renovation firm bundling painting into a full package. Expect estimates to be provided per square meter, per room, or as a project total (varies / depends).

Emergency pricing: True 24/7 “emergency painting” is uncommon because coatings need drying time and proper ventilation. Urgent jobs (like a fast repaint before move-in) may cost more due to overtime labor, compressed scheduling, or weekend work (varies / depends).

What affects cost (most important variables)

  • Surface condition: cracks, peeling, water stains, mold treatment needs
  • Scope of prep: patching, skim coating, sanding, primer requirements
  • Paint system: economy vs premium; washable/mildew-resistant formulas
  • Number of coats and color changes (deep colors often need more coverage)
  • Protection and complexity: furniture moving, masking, high ceilings, detailed trim
  • Timeline: tight deadlines, night work, multi-trade coordination

To control cost without sacrificing quality, ask each Painter to provide a written scope that separates prep labor from paint/material grade and states exactly how many coats are included.

Should I buy paint myself or let the Painter supply it?

Either can work. Supplying paint yourself improves control over brand/grade, but you must match primer/topcoat compatibility and quantities. Letting the Painter supply materials can simplify warranty conversations—confirm the exact product line in writing.

How long does interior painting take for an apartment in Tianjin?

Varies / depends on size, drying conditions, and prep. Repaints with minimal repairs can be quicker; heavy patching, skim coating, or damp walls extend timelines. Ask for a day-by-day plan (prep, primer, coat 1, coat 2, touch-ups).

What should be included in a professional painting quote?

At minimum: area/rooms covered, surface repairs, protection/masking, primer and number of coats, paint brand/series, color count, cleanup, and touch-up policy. Also confirm who moves furniture and how damage is handled.

Can a Painter fix peeling paint or wall cracks?

Yes—if they include the right prep steps. Peeling paint often needs scraping, feather sanding, sealing/priming, and sometimes moisture diagnosis. Cracks may require mesh tape, filler, sanding, and leveling; confirm what method they use.

How do I know the paint is safe for kids or low-odor?

Ask for the exact product name/series and documentation the supplier provides. Ventilation matters as much as the label. If odor sensitivity is a concern, plan for airflow and curing time before moving in (varies / depends).
